Handful of Hazelnuts
Hazelnuts, also known as filberts, are grown right here in the Pacific Northwest! Did you know that 99% of hazelnuts grown in the United States are grown in Oregon alone? Eating them raw is d’lish but have you tried roasting them? Many recipes call for roasted...
